Flames Post Impressive Results at House of Champions

Men Hold Off Ball State; Women Top All Conference Teams

11/18/2021 9:12:00 PM

UIC finished action at the House of Champions invitational at IUPUI Saturday, holding on to impressive team finishes while showing off their depth in several events.

The men finished third, holding off Ball State by three points.  Only local D-II powerhouse UIndy and the hosts finished ahead of the Flames.  On the women's side, UIC placed fourth.  They trailed Illinois, Ball State, and UIndy, and finished almost 90 points ahead of league rival Milwaukee.

Cydney Liebenberg showed once again to be one of the region's top divers.  She added a 3-meter title to the 1-meter win that she achieved Friday.  The 100 free was a big event for UIC, with Flames men and women well-represented in the final heats.  In other events, including the 200 fly, few if any Horizon League swimmers finished ahead of the Flames' top finishers.  UIC will look to replicate that success when they return to the IUPUI Natatorium for the conference championships in February.

The Flames will take an extended training break until early January.  They will return to competition with their first home meet of the season, a two-day triple dual against Cleveland State and IUPUI.

Saturday's Top Performers
  • Cydney Liebenberg completed the diving sweep with a win in the 3-meter event.  She was remarkably consistent, scoring 276.80 in the prelims and 275.45 in the finals.
  • Cole Tremewan came in second in 1-meter diving.  Felix Lafortune qualified for the B-final, but once there, put up a final round score of 316.70 that was the second highest across all heats.
  • Christina Neri came in sixth in the 1650 free, one spot ahead of Victoria Thor.
  • Liam Davis, in eighth, paced the men in the 1650.
  • Ashlee Weltyk (12th) and Anna Scovill (19th) swam in final heats of the 200 back.
  • Owen Zant came in sixth in the 200 back.
  • Poleena Kovalaske turned in a fourth place swim in the 100 free.  Kalie Landrum and Beth Kelzer made the B- and C-finals respectively.
  • Jeff Wiedoff was sixth in the 100 free.  Josh Dellorto and Cory Michalek also made it to the finals.
  • Taira Juronis was eighth in the 200 breast.  Ben Ramminger was the men's highest finisher in the event.
  • Lilly Culp was eighth in the 200 fly, and the top finisher among Horizon League swimmers.
  • Kyle Lewarchick and Liam Davis came in seventh and eighth in the 200 fly.
Saturday's Relay Results
  • The quartet of Landrum, Bree Moericke, Kelzer, and Kovalaske came in fifth in the 400 free relay.
  • Wiedoff, Michalek, Lewarchick, and Dellorto turned in a sixth place finish in the 400 free relay.
Friday's Top Performers
  • Cydney Liebenberg won the 1-meter diving competition with a season-best score of 291.00 in the final.  Ciara McCliment took third place, also with a personal season high.
  • Lilly Culp qualified for the A-final in the 100 fly.  Izabella Del Rosario was the only other Flame to make a final heat in the event.
  • Jeff Wiedoff broke the 50-second mark in the 100 fly, where he was joined in the B-final by Josh Dellorto.
  • Ashton Amerman was the team's top finisher in the 400 IM.
  • Kyle Lewarchick and Liam Davis both made the A-final in the 400 IM.  They finished sixth and eighth respectively.
  • Felix Lafortune was the winner in 3-meter diving.  Cole Tremewan also dove in the A-final.
  • Victoria Thor and Kalie Landrum paced the team in the 200 free, qualifying for the A-final.  A quartet of Flames, including Lizzie Zeller, Jessica Phillips, Bree Moericke, and Maddie Hawker also qualified for final heats.
  • Jan Komorowski came in fourth in the 200 free.
  • Taira Juronis won the 100 breast B-final.  Poleena Kovalaske and Sam Malecki also swam in that heat.
  • Ben Ramminger also was a 100 breast B-final winner.
  • Anna Scovill was the top Flame in the 100 back.
  • Cory Michalek placed fourth in the 100 back.  Owen Zant and Luke Wiesner finished back-to-back in the B-final.
Friday Relay Results
  • Scovill, Juronis, Del Rosario, and Kovalaske had an impressive third place showing in the 200 medley relay.
  • The women also finished third in the 800 free relay, with Landrum, Thor, Moericke, and Zeller doing the honors.
  • Michalek, Ramminger, Liam Davis, and Jeff Wiedoff posted the team's best time of the season in the 200 medley relay.
  • Dellorto, Komorowski, Tyler Schwertfeger, and Lewarchick combined to come in fourth in the 800 free relay.
Thursday's Top Performers
  • UIC placed a meet-high seven women in the three heats of 500 freestyle finals.  Victoria Thor finished third, with Ashton Amerman and Lizzie Zeller also among the team's leaders.
  • Jan Komorowski was UIC's highest finisher in the men's 500 free.  Tyler Schwertfeger and Ben Ramminger also qualified for the finals.
  • Taira Juronis had UIC's best time in the 200 IM, while Sam Malecki won the C-final.
  • Kyle Lewarchick won the B-final in the 200 IM.
  • Poleena Kovalaske had the Flames' fastest sprint (23.31) in the 50 free.
  • Jeff Wiedoff and Cory Michalek swam in the B-final in the 50 free.
  • Cydney Liebenberg was the only competitor in the women's platform diving event.  She scored 204.90 in the final, five-dive round.
Thursday Relay Results
  • Kovalaske, Bree Moericke, Beth Kelzer, and Izabella Del Rosario had UIC's best time of the season in the 200 free relay.
  • Zeller, Taira Juronis, Lilly Culp, and Kovalaske finished fourth in the 400 medley relay.
  • Jeff Wiedoff, Josh Dellorto, Liam Davis, and Michalek remained intact as the Flames' 200 free relay A-team.
  • Owen Zant, Ben Ramminger, Wiedoff, and Dellorto comprised the 400 medley relay squad.
